What do engineering control systems aim to do regarding airborne pathogens?

Explanation:
Engineering control systems are designed to limit exposure to airborne pathogens or remove them from the workplace environment. This approach focuses on modifying the environment or using technology to create barriers or adequately ventilate areas to reduce the concentration of pathogens in the air. Such measures can include improved ventilation systems, air filtration, and physical barriers that help minimize the transmission of airborne diseases. By prioritizing the limitation of exposure, engineering controls provide an effective means of protecting individuals in various settings, especially where pathogens are more likely to be present. This method is crucial as it addresses the root cause of exposure in a systematic way, thereby enhancing the overall safety and health of the workplace without solely relying on personal hygiene practices or manual cleaning efforts. Understanding the significance of engineering controls is crucial for effective infection control and prevention strategies in settings such as healthcare facilities, detention centers, and other environments where the risk of airborne pathogens is present.
